Automatic Winding Machine For Cylindrical Cell Production
1. Equipment Description:
This device is employed in the manufacturing of cylindrical lithium-ion battery cells and stands as a critical piece of equipment in battery production. Its operational process is outlined below: The cathode sheets, anode sheets, and separator—preprocessed by the slitting machine—are actively unwound. They then go through a series of steps including tension control, dust removal, web alignment, iron removal, static elimination for the separator, and quality inspection. Subsequently, they are fed into the winding section via guide rollers and electrode feeding mechanisms. Once winding is done, the cell is picked up by a robotic arm, undergoes short-circuit testing, is counted by a photoelectric counter, and conveyed to the collection platform via a conveyor belt. If any defective cells are detected during processing, they are rejected and directed to the defective product collection box.

4. Equipment Structure Overview:
Electrode Feeding System (Cathode/Anode)
l Unwinding Stand: Single-arm, dual-support, servo-driven with auto-guiding and pneumatic expansion
l Tension Control: Potentiometer with swing arm; adjustable tension
l Dust Removal: Dual-brush + vacuum extraction system
l Web Guiding: Optical sensors and correction actuators
l Feeding Unit: Servo-driven, front/rear de-ironing
Separator Feeding System
l Same structure as electrode feeding
l Includes static elimination and web guiding
Winding Section
l Three-needle, three-position setup
l Pneumatic needle shifting
l Servo-driven rotation, closed-loop angle/speed control
l Scissor-type electrode cutting with dust removal
l Pneumatic tooth-blade separator and tape cutting
l Pneumatic robotic arm for cell discharge
l Short-circuit detection (100–500V DC, 1–9μA)
Tape Feeding
l Passive unwind
l Cylinder-driven unrolling and pressing
l V-blade cutting
Cell Transfer System
l Intermittent belt conveyor, synchronized with machine cycle
l Separates good/defective cells
l Buffer zone ≥8 cells
Machine Frame
l Welded 50×100 steel structure, stress-relieved
l Double-sided ground wall panels
l Aluminum guide rollers, hard anodized, ≤30μm runout
l Left-side electric cabinet, separated zones for strong/weak current
l Fault display via touch screen & protected switches
l Alarm functions: material-end, break, short circuit, missing tabs, etc.
l Rejects defective cells automatically
l Cell counting and length measuring, alarms if ≥3 consecutive anomalies
l Equipped with safety guards
